Leading pointers for managing your IBS:

Visit your G.P. first

Alluring as it is to self-diagnose (yeah, we’ve all saw Dr. Google), it’s essential to make certain your signs and symptoms are down to IBS, since bloating, belly discomfort or an adjustment in your poo can be an indicator of other problems including coeliac condition and also Crohn’s.

A visit to your G.P. and an easy blood test will certainly help to identify whether it is IBS, aiding to obtain you on the appropriate path to handling your symptoms. Do not stress regarding reviewing poo with your G.P.— we promise they’ve heard all of it before. If you can, take a signs and symptom diary to help explain what you’re experiencing.

Be familiar with your IBS

Not all IBS coincides— various kinds require various therapies. Recognizing your kind will certainly help you manage your signs and symptoms better.

IBS-C (irregularity) explains stomach discomfort and also seldom (less than 3 times a week), lumpy or difficult poos. IBS-D (diarrhoea) is belly pain with loosened as well as watery poos. If your poo alternates in between the two, you’re in the IBS-M (mixed) camp.

Make the caffeine button

If your latte routine is more powerful than Arnie’s bicep, it’s time for a rethink. Caffeine is an all-natural laxative and also can worsen IBS-D as well as heartburn. Adhere to no more than 2 caffeinated drinks each day (tea, coffee, soda), and swap in caffeine free choices like rooibos, peppermint or lemon as well as ginger.

Readjust your alcohol intake

Boozy evenings might be fun but they can worsen tummy pain, cause modifications in intestine bacteria and also cause loosened feceses. A max of 1-2 beverages each time is suggested, with 1-2 booze free nights a week— great for your tummy, good for your body.

Change your fiber consumption

Fiber aids us poo— but also for people with IBS it isn’t always handy. Consuming lots much more fibre can make gas worse, so picking the ideal kind is essential.

If you have IBS-C, upping some sorts of fibre consumption can aid. Try oats for breakfast, snack on fruits (bananas, berries, kiwi, oranges and also pineapple are IBS-friendly) or supplement with linseeds (approximately 2 tbsp. per day). If you are enhancing your fibre intake, do so slowly over the area of a couple of weeks as well as see to it you consume alcohol a lot of water— without water, fiber can not do its work.

If on the various other diarrhea is the problem, reducing your fiber consumption can help— select lower fibre cereals (this might suggests switching over to white pasta as well as rice), decreasing fiber from beans and raw veggies, and also staying clear of skins, pips, and also peels off.

Swap gassy veggies

Hummus, beans, peas lentils as well as other veggies (cabbage, cauliflower, broccoli as well as onions) tend to generate great deals of gas, which can trigger bloating and discomfort for individuals with IBS.

Have smaller sized parts of these veggies, and also add in much less windy alternatives like spinach, kale, carrots as well as Mediterranean veg— aubergines, courgettes as well as tomatoes.

Find out to handle stress and anxiety

Anxiety doesn’t just tire brains; it can likewise play mayhem with digestion, as anxiety hormones are grabbed by your stomach, as well as can trigger IBS-symptoms, which implies that dealing with diet regimen alone may not offer you with the alleviation you are looking for. Integrate in time to kick back every day— yoga and mindfulness have both been revealed to have a favorable impact on IBS signs.
